Known on campus as the con lounge, it serves as the social hub of Oberlin Conservatory. It is in the Central Unit in one of the main throughways of the complex. It’s distinguished by its large floor-to-ceiling windows that overlook the koi pond. The multipurpose space offers opportunities for students to gather, relax, socialize, and perhaps enjoy art work periodically exhibited along the walls of the lounge area.

Community events take place here as well as holiday performances and postconcert receptions.
